Isaiah 57:9-11
Holman Christian Standard Bible
9 You went to the king with oil
and multiplied your perfumes;
you sent your couriers far away(A)
and sent them down even to Sheol.
10 You became weary on your many journeys,
but you did not say, “I give up!”(B)
You found a renewal of your strength;[a]
therefore you did not grow weak.
11 Who was it you dreaded and feared,
so that you lied and didn’t remember Me
or take it to heart?
Have I not kept silent for such a long time[b](C)
and you do not fear Me?
Footnotes
- Isaiah 57:10 Lit found life of your hand
- Isaiah 57:11 LXX reads And I, when I see you, I pass by
